In 2024, TWO MEN AND A TRUCK is excited to announce that due to overwhelming demand and growth, the company has moved its junk removal business to its own standalone brand called TWO MEN AND A JUNK TRUCK in greater Milwaukee!

From a small start, hauling unwanted items away for customers during moves over five years ago, to investing in specific trucks equipped and designed to make haul-away much more efficient, the company now has a junk removal team of 15 people, with five trucks in two locations, serving customers from Racine to Sheboygan, Whitefish Bay to Cross Plains.
